Water, Water,Water! Private Boatable Pier across the street from the Beach! Huge 6BR-4BA: BR1; Master BR with a King, BR2;2Q, BR3; 1Q, BR4;1Q, BR5:2T, BR6:1K . Spectacular 5000+ square ft. sound-front home in a rare location directly across the street from the ocean with a private lighted pier, dock and pet friendly with a 2 dog limit!. Bring your own power boats or Kayaks for the ultimate beach vacation. With only 2 rows of houses in this area, the beach is never crowded. Decks or patios on every level all with views of the beach or the sound. Copacetic offers elevator access, a massive great room with a wall of windows with amazing views of the sound and waterway. The enormous kitchen is fully equipped for your preparation of fabulous meals for your large group. With large Prep areas and 8 Barstool seating areas, everyone can be a part of the action. The long and wide dining room table comfortably seats 14. The living area has two large sectionals where everyone can enjoy your favorite movies or television on the 70” HD Smart TV (with digital cable, Blue ray player with movies, Chromecast and easy hookups for your own devices). High Speed Wireless Internet, stereo, games and puzzles complete your entertainment amenities on this level. A separate recreation room offers a Pool Table, digital Keyboard, refrigerator and seating area complete with another large screen TV. Additional TV’s are in the Master Bedroom (BR #1) and BR #2. Bedrooms are all large providing ample space for nighttime relaxation. Additional amenities include a Washer/Dryer, Hot/Cold Outside Shower, charcoal grill and a fish cleaning station on the pier. Large covered carport area, Sun Decks sound side and beach side, sound side screened porch and a ground floor sound side covered patio. Ample onsite parking. Easy beach access and close to Blue Water Point Marina boat ramp for launching your boat or dining out. Stretch out at Copacetic for the perfect family vacation. Pet Friendly, No smoking. Linens included in weekly and less than 7 day stays only. 5 night minimum rates available in Value - Resort Seasons. Please call our office to inquire.Check-In: 3-5PM Check-Out: 10:00AM.

Overall, we truly enjoyed the stay at Copacetic. There are some safety concerns for very young children that we are contacting the property managers about. The open layout upstairs was wonderful for the whole family. The sectionals are comfortable even though not brand new. The bedrooms are all good sized and mattresses comfortable. The hot water was a bit sketchy in some bathrooms going in and out during showers. The ice maker and wine fridge upstairs were great to have and the kitchen was very nice overall. We would likely stay again if some safety concerns were addressed.

Not so Copacetic
The location was great, the view from the back of the house was gorgeous. The space was adequate for our group. HOWEVER, it is not worth the cost. We had to call service/maintenance several times in the first 2 days. The TV remotes did not have batteries, the hot water wasn't working in the kitchen, the oven didn't work correctly, we went 2 days without AC in the kitchen/great room area! One bedroom had extensive water damage and smelled like mold so no one was allowed to stay in that room. There were no dish rags or towels or detergent. We found broken glass in one of the bedrooms, and we found ants in the pantry. The owner needs to take this property out of the inventory for a couple of months and get everything updated/fixed/cleaned. Overall a disappointment for the amount of money we paid.
Nice location very near the beach with a great view of the sound and a very nice, large kitchen. But..all of the interior bedroom and bathroom doors are louvered doors. You can't see through them but you can hear everything so there is no real privacy within the bedrooms and baths. During our stay this time we had trouble with the hot water. Sometimes it would be hot and then just turn cold with no warning, It seems that the most likely cause is that the hot water system is simply not sufficient for a house this large with 12 people staying there. Otherwise a very nice place.
